Understanding Car Key Transponder Programming and Why It Matters

Car key transponder programming is the precise process of synchronising a tiny electronic chip hidden inside your key head with your vehicle’s Engine Control Unit (ECU). It acts as a digital handshake. Without this specific pairing, your car simply won't start. Since 1995, UK legislation has mandated that all new cars sold must be fitted with an immobiliser system to combat rising theft rates. This shift transformed the car key from a simple piece of cut metal into a sophisticated security device. Even if a thief manages to pick your door lock or force the ignition barrel, the vehicle remains immobile without the correct electronic authorisation.

It helps to view your modern key as two distinct tools working in tandem. The physical blade is mechanical; it turns the locks and operates the ignition cylinder. However, the transponder is purely electronic. A perfectly cut key that hasn't undergone professional car key transponder programming is essentially useless for driving. It might grant you entry to the cabin, but the engine will stay dead. This dual-layer security ensures that physical access alone is no longer enough to steal a modern vehicle.

The Role of the Transponder Chip

Inside the plastic head of your key sits a passive Radio Frequency Identification (RFID) chip. This component is clever because it doesn't require a battery to function. Instead, an induction coil located around your ignition barrel creates a small electromagnetic field. This field powers the chip the moment you insert the key. This triggers a high-speed "challenge-response" sequence. The ECU sends a request, and the chip must provide the matching encrypted answer within milliseconds. You can think of the transponder as the digital passport of your vehicle. Transponder Keys vs. Remote Fobs: What is the Difference?

Many drivers confuse their remote buttons with the transponder chip, but they are separate systems. The remote fob usually requires a battery and controls your central locking and alarm. If your remote battery dies, you can still start the car manually using the blade. The transponder is what communicates directly with the engine. You could have a key that unlocks the door perfectly but fails to start the engine because the chip is damaged or unprogrammed. Modern "smart keys" now integrate both functions into one seamless circuit, making expert car key transponder programming even more vital for your mobility.

How Transponder Chips and Immobiliser Systems Work Together

The security of your vehicle relies on a silent conversation that happens in the blink of an eye. When you insert your key or press the start button, an induction coil located around the ignition barrel acts as a miniature antenna. It sends out a burst of electromagnetic energy that wakes up the passive chip inside your key. The Engine Control Unit (ECU) then steps in as the gatekeeper. It waits for a specific, encrypted response from that chip. This technical synergy is the core of how an immobilizer works to prevent unauthorised engine starts.

Modern 2026 models have evolved beyond simple static codes. They now utilise "rolling code" technology. This means the digital password changes every single time the car is started. If a thief attempts to record the signal, that code is already obsolete by the time they try to use it. This advanced encryption makes relay theft significantly more difficult. To manage these complex systems, locksmiths use the OBD-II port. This port is the direct gateway to the vehicle's brain. Professional car key transponder programming requires connecting specialised diagnostic tools to this port to "introduce" a new key to the car’s authorised list. The Digital Handshake Process

The verification process is a high-speed sequence that completes before you even finish turning the key. First, the car sends a "challenge" signal. The key chip receives this and calculates a "response" based on its internal encryption. Finally, the ECU compares this response against its stored data. If the handshake fails, the engine may crank but will never fire. You will typically see a padlock icon on the dashboard or a "Key Not Recognised" message. Because the ECU controls the fuel injection and ignition timing, "hotwiring" is effectively impossible on modern UK vehicles. The hardware is physically locked out until the digital software says yes.

Diagnostic Programming vs. Key Cloning

It is vital to understand the difference between cloning and diagnostic programming. Cloning involves taking an existing, working key and copying its digital identity onto a new chip. Whilst this is a quick fix for a spare, it doesn't help if you have lost all your keys. Diagnostic programming is a much more robust solution. Instead of copying an old ID, the locksmith enters the car's system via the OBD port and grants a brand-new, unique ID to the vehicle's memory. This method allows the technician to delete any lost or stolen keys from the car’s database. It ensures that only the keys currently in your possession can start the engine, providing a higher level of security and peace of mind.

Common Symptoms of a Faulty Transponder and How to Diagnose Them

Check your dashboard immediately if your engine refuses to fire. The most obvious sign of a failure is the "Immobiliser Warning Light." This is typically a yellow or red icon shaped like a key or a padlock. If this light flashes rapidly or stays illuminated after you turn the ignition, your vehicle has failed to verify the key’s digital signature. In these cases, your car key transponder programming is the primary suspect for the lockout.

Another classic symptom is the "start-and-stall" behaviour. Your engine might roar to life for exactly one second before abruptly dying. This happens because the ECU allows a momentary ignition but cuts the fuel supply once the security handshake fails. Alternatively, the engine may simply crank indefinitely without ever igniting. This confirms that the gatekeeper has not authorised the start. Intermittent failures are equally common and often more frustrating. You might find the key works on the third or fourth attempt, only to fail again the next morning. This usually points to a loose chip inside the key casing or minor internal damage that prevents a clean signal. Don't ignore these early warning signs. A key that works "sometimes" will eventually stop working altogether, usually at the most inconvenient moment possible.

Is It the Battery or the Programming?

It is a common misconception that a dead fob battery prevents your car from starting. Most transponders are passive RFID chips. They draw power from the induction coil around the ignition, not from the internal battery. If your remote buttons don't unlock the doors but the car starts fine, you only need a battery. However, if the buttons work but the car won't start, the transponder programming is likely corrupted. Use this quick checklist to narrow down the fault:

  • Test the remote buttons for central locking response.

  • Try your spare key to see if the symptoms persist across both keys.

  • Watch the dashboard for flashing security icons during the cranking process.

What Causes a Transponder to "Lose" Its Code?

Physical trauma is the leading cause of chip failure. Dropping your keys on hard pavement can crack the delicate glass or carbon casing of the transponder chip. Whilst rare, strong electromagnetic interference can also de-synchronise older systems. In some instances, the fault lies within the vehicle itself. EEPROM corruption in the car’s security module can cause it to "forget" authorised keys. This internal software glitch requires professional tools to wipe the memory and perform fresh car key transponder programming to restore access and security.

Is it possible to reprogramme a second-hand key from another vehicle?

Reprogramming a second-hand key from another vehicle is rarely possible for modern UK cars. Most transponder chips are "locked" to a specific VIN once they are paired for the first time. These chips are designed to be write-once for security reasons, meaning they cannot be wiped and reused on a different car. For a reliable result, we always recommend using a fresh, unprogrammed transponder chip for your vehicle.

Does my car key need a battery for the transponder to work?

Your car key does not require a battery for the transponder chip to function and start the engine. The transponder is a passive RFID device that is powered by the electromagnetic field generated by the ignition's induction coil. The battery inside your key fob is strictly for the remote central locking and alarm functions. This is why you can still drive your car even if the remote battery has completely failed.
